About the Glowlight Tetra
Glowlight Tetras (Hemigrammus erythrozonus) are small, peaceful freshwater fish known for their vibrant, glowing red stripe and schooling behavior. They are popular in the aquarium hobby due to their attractive appearance and easy-going nature. These fish are relatively small, reaching about 1.5 inches (4cm) in length. They are characterized by a bright red stripe that runs horizontally along their body, from snout to tail, and their other fins are transparent.
Husbandry & Care
Temperament: Peaceful
Minimum Tank Size: 15 Gallons
Water Temperature: 75-82 °F
Water pH: 5.5-7.5
Social Group: 6+ Fish
Diet: Omnivorous; this species will readily consume commercial flakes/pellets, live baby brine shrimp, daphnia, frozen brine shrimp/bloodworms
Compatible with: Bettas, Dwarf Gourami, Honey Gourami, Neocaridina Shrimp, Amano Shrimp, Neon Tetras, Cardinal Tetras, Apistogramma sp., Mystery Snails, Nerite Snails.
